Musical Stories Workshop
Our Musical Stories workshop brings stories to life through music, movement and sound. Children explore familiar and imaginative tales using live music and a range of instruments, discovering how rhythm, pitch and dynamics can help tell a story in fun and engaging ways.
Designed for EYFS and Key Stage 1, the workshop supports listening, communication and creative development while encouraging children to take part through movement and simple instrument playing. Pupils build confidence and musical understanding as they work together, responding to music and stories in an inclusive and joyful shared experience.
Curriculum Links
Early Years Foundation Stage
Expressive Arts and Design
-
Explore and play with sounds, movement and music
-
Use music and imagination to represent ideas and stories
-
Respond creatively to live music
Communication and Language
-
Develop listening and attention skills
-
Follow simple instructions and take part in shared activities
-
Use language to describe sounds, actions and stories
Personal, Social and Emotional Development
-
Build confidence through group participation
-
Take turns, share ideas and work collaboratively
-
Experience enjoyment and engagement in shared music-making


Key Stage 1
Music
-
Use voices and instruments expressively and creatively
-
Explore rhythm, pitch, dynamics and structure
-
Listen with concentration and respond to live music
-
Perform as part of a group
English
-
Develop listening, speaking and comprehension skills
-
Respond to stories through discussion and creative expression
-
Use language to describe ideas, characters and events
